Decoding the Blueprint of Your 2009 Dodge Journey's Electrical System

A 2009 Dodge Journey wiring diagram is essentially a visual representation of all the electrical connections within your vehicle. It shows how different components, such as the battery, alternator, lights, radio, engine control module, and various sensors, are interconnected by wires. These diagrams are not just random lines and symbols; they follow a standardized system that makes them decipherable for those who know how to read them. They are crucial for identifying wire colors, connector types, and the path electricity takes to power every function in your Journey.

The primary use of a 2009 Dodge Journey wiring diagram is for troubleshooting electrical issues. When a light doesn't work, a sensor is malfunctioning, or an accessory isn't operating correctly, the wiring diagram helps pinpoint the problem. Mechanics use it to trace the circuit, identify potential breaks in wires, faulty grounds, or short circuits. For DIYers, it empowers them to tackle repairs themselves, saving time and money. Beyond repairs, the 2009 Dodge Journey wiring diagram is invaluable for installing aftermarket accessories, such as new stereos, alarms, or auxiliary lighting, ensuring proper connections and preventing damage to the existing electrical system.

Here’s a glimpse into what you’ll find within a typical 2009 Dodge Journey wiring diagram:

Symbol Meaning
Lines Represent wires or conductors.
Circles Often indicate connection points or splices.
Rectangles/Squares Typically represent components like relays, fuses, or switches.
Labels Denote wire colors, component names, and circuit designations.

The importance of having the correct 2009 Dodge Journey wiring diagram cannot be overstated for accurate and safe electrical work. Without it, you're essentially working blindfolded, increasing the risk of errors, damage to your vehicle's electronics, or even personal injury.

  1. Always ensure the diagram corresponds to the specific model year and trim level of your 2009 Dodge Journey.
  2. Familiarize yourself with the legend and symbols used in the diagram before proceeding with any work.
  3. Cross-reference information with other diagnostic tools or service manuals if available.
